Sporting Lisbon striker Cristiano Ronaldo will be presented as a new Manchester United player this week, Portuguese TV reported this evening.

RTP reported that the youngster’s agent Jorge Mendes met United officials tonight and struck a deal to bring the 18-year-old to Old Trafford.

The reports say that the player could be formally presented as early as tomorrow and that he will get a five-year contract while the deal is said to be worth €12m to the Portuguese outfit.

Sporting Lisbon president Antonio Dias de Cunha will not confirm or deny the reports while, United also declined to comment.

United and Sporting had earlier this year agreed a partnership deal.
